2. How can the angle between two lines be calculated in 3D geometry?
Ans. To calculate the angle between two lines in 3D geometry, we can use the dot product formula. Let the direction vectors of the two lines be A and B. The angle θ between the lines can be found using the formula: θ = arccos((A.B) / (|A||B|)), where A.B denotes the dot product of A and B, and |A| and |B| represent the magnitudes of vectors A and B, respectively.
